| Executive class passengers and 
Garuda Frequent Flyer (GFF) Platinum members can now check-in, pay their
 airport taxes, make another reservation, purchase new tickets or 
re-route their flights using the new exclusive check-in counters. 
 “The
 launch of the premium check-in area is part of our commitment to 
continually improve and deliver the best service to our passengers.
 
 “It’s
 part of what we call the ‘Garuda Indonesia Experience’, the concept of 
service that combines the warm atmosphere and hospitality typical of 
Indonesia and covers pre-journey, pre-flight, in-flight and 
post-journey,” said Nicodemus Lampe, vice president, area Asia, Garuda 
Indonesia.
 
 For GFF Platinum cardholders, the airline will also 
provide a Personal Service Assistant (PSA) who will help passengers with
 their check-in process while they relax in the designated waiting area.
